Ninety years ago this week, the 19th Amendment to the U.S. Constitution was ratified, and American women were given the right to vote for the first time. The suffragettes of 1920, who accomplished this amazing feat, would surely recognize the economic fury and frustration driving their 21st century sisters to political action in 2010. (more)
